前言文本它们的定义Struts1commons-digester.jar解析XML实现XML标签到对象的转换1.依据目标XML的结构定义解析规则文件參照rule.xml2.创建集合对象接收封装解析的XMLModelConfig config = new ModelConfig();Digester ...
分类:
其他好文 时间:
2015-08-18 18:59:24
阅读次数:
122
2010-07-17 13:21:42 org.apache.tomcat.util.digester.SetPropertiesRule begin警告: [SetPropertiesRule]{Server/Service/Engine/Host/Context} Setting propert...
分类:
系统相关 时间:
2015-08-08 10:16:02
阅读次数:
195
源码面前,了无秘密。继之前阅读了Prototype、Spring、Tomcat、以及JDK的部分、Digester等等源码之后,学习一门技术,了解源码成了必备流程。也深深的感受到了源码面前,了无秘密的含义,同时也体会到它给我带来的好处。同时,也希望所有开发者,不论前端后端,如果有时间的话,都尽量.....
分类:
其他好文 时间:
2015-06-29 11:40:32
阅读次数:
151
2015-6-12?11:51:33?org.apache.tomcat.util.digester.SetPropertiesRule?begin
警告:?[SetPropertiesRule]{Server/Service/Engine/Host/Context}?Setting?property?‘source‘?to?‘org.eclipse.jst.jee....
分类:
其他好文 时间:
2015-06-12 15:25:18
阅读次数:
228
在Java编程中,配置文件大多数都是用xml文件来组织的。所以在Java语言中处理xml的工具就特别多。在java中解析XML的几种方式,应该都是知道的。在这些解析技术的基础之上,又发展了几种优秀Object/XML关联的技术,例如有一种对象绑定技术(JAXB),再例如Digester。这里就来简....
分类:
编程语言 时间:
2015-06-09 11:12:19
阅读次数:
108
在tomcat启动的时候,出现这个警告:log4j:WARNNoappenderscouldbefoundforlogger(org.apache.commons.digester.Digester.sax).log4j:WARNPleaseinitializethelog4jsystemprope...
分类:
其他好文 时间:
2015-05-22 00:04:58
阅读次数:
179
Cookbook就是工具书,应该是前年看的,在中关村看的影印版,全英文,本书主要讲解了一下模块:Core:BeanUtils,Lang,Collections,loggingDb:DbUtils,DBCP,PoolIO: IO,XML vs Bean:betwixt,Digester,JXPath,...
分类:
其他好文 时间:
2015-04-27 13:11:59
阅读次数:
387
在这一节里我们说说ContextConfig这个类。
这个类在很早的时候我们就已经使用了(之前那个叫SimpleContextConfig),但是在之前它干的事情都很简单,就是吧context里的configured变量置为true。在这里我们看看完整版的ContextConfig都干了什么。
在tomcat的实际部署中,StandContext类的实际监听器是org.apache.catal...
分类:
其他好文 时间:
2014-12-12 16:40:01
阅读次数:
150
Digester库
在前面的几个章节里,我们对tomcat里各个组件的配置完全是使用写硬编码的形式完成的。
如
Context context = new StandardContext();
Loader loader = new WebappLoader();
context.setLoader(loader);就完成了向context容器里添加WepappLoader的功能。
这...
分类:
其他好文 时间:
2014-12-08 13:56:20
阅读次数:
244
Catalina的作用是初始化各个组件,并开始启动各个组件。
上文中介绍了Bootstrap是如何启动Catalina的,现在来看看Catalina的作用:
1,Catalina或通过Digester类加载server.xml,获取server.xml中各个组件的实例,并赋值(这个类是通过扩展SAX来完成的)。
2,调用server的start方法开启server组件,server会一级一级...
分类:
其他好文 时间:
2014-11-05 19:48:47
阅读次数:
245